In 1468, Ellen Talbot entered the world in Salesbury, Blackburn, Lancashire, England, United Kingdom, born to Sir John Talbot And Anne Ashton. Ellen Talbot married John George Singleton, and had children including Allison Singleton. Ellen Talbot passed away in 1530 in Broughton, Preston, Lancashire, England, United Kingdom.
